Irene's POV:

She had stretched out her legs, leaning against a metallic pipe. A medium-sized candle laid on her lap, waiting to catch fire. The floor was cold and uncomfortable.

She had been waiting in their usual cubbyhole for almost ten minutes now and there was still no sight of her expected visitor. Usually, Irene was the one who came late.

She took the candle and rolled it over her thigh, feeling the wax touching her soft skin. Irene just hoped Seulgi would take a match with her. If not, they would be left in darkness. She wouldn't mind, but Seulgi got a little nervous when somebody took her eyesight.

The excitement grew from minute to minute, leaving the feeling of hundreds of butterflies in her stomach. Sometimes she felt like she got a long-distance relationship with Seulgi. The worst part was that she saw her every day, these cold and careless features that didn't resemble the real Seulgi.

Finally, after two weeks, she could feel her again. She could hear her real voice, her softness and gentle touches, see her deep eyes and smell her unique scent. Irene would never admit it, but she had missed the girl.

She just hoped Seulgi wouldn't come up with bad news.

Between their last meeting, many things had happened. The fact that she had vomited onto the compost heap was just one out of many things Seulgi had to explain. Irene wanted to be involved in her thoughts. She knew about the outlines of the plan. But couldn't tell anything about the details.

Besides, the feeling of concern and frustration built up in her stomach. What would happen if they fail? What would happen if she wasn't strong enough to follow the plan? On the one hand, she would do everything for Seulgi.

But Seulgi could be selfish and cold-hearted toward others. Irene couldn't handle it to disappoint others. Or even worse: To disappoint herself.

A soft knocking appeared, causing Irene to flinch. She hesitated, thinking about plausible reasons why she sat in an abandoned, dark cubbyhole. She just hoped that it wasn't one of the authorities.

A silent 'yes' escaped her mouth as she had gotten up. The door opened; a small ray of light entered the room. "Irene?", Seulgi's voice appeared.

Irene waited until Seulgi had closed the door, then she fell into Seulgi's arms. Two hands pressed her closer, her head resting on Seulgi's shoulder. She inhaled the sweet scent of her and kissed her neck.

She felt how Seulgi stroke her hair while whispering something Irene couldn't understand. How she had missed it.

They both stayed like that, Seulgi had wrapped her arms protectively around Irene, both standing in the middle of the room without moving. After a minute, Seulgi cupped Irene's face.
